Manage institutional and card product (BIN) licensing, deletions/de-commissions, portfolio conversions, ordering new BINs, etc.
Ownership of CSI responsibilities (PBIO, CMP ownership, EERS reassessment, SOX review, ARCM)
Responsible for partnering with the vendors, Mastercard and Visa.
Track and coordinate entitlements to external network (MC, Visa, AmEx) portals.
Partner with other Citi employees across the Global and at all levels of the business.
Coordinate issues and questions around Network rules and compliance that impact Citi Operations.
Coordinate cross-functional meetings for planning and executing operational changes between Citi and the Networks.

The Ops Sup Lead Analyst is a senior level position responsible for providing operations support services, including but not limited to; record/documentation maintenance, storage & retrieval of records, account maintenance, imaging and the opening of accounts in coordination with the Operations - Core Team. Additionally, the Ops Sup Lead Analyst serves as the liaison between operations staff, relationship managers, project managers, custodians and clients. The overall objective of this role is to provide day-to-day operations support in alignment with Citi operations support infrastructure and processes.
